Output 21498121a194f53dbfca81b8a6b7782c7e42990cc09c73c9cf4b46682e39888a:0

value
63040
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4813335e2ddd4d535cea05242568be24241d0ce OP_EQUALVERIFY OP_CHECKSIG
address
1PHpenQVtKuRdMupqGEnqQawqqUtXXPdFB
transaction
21498121a194f53dbfca81b8a6b7782c7e42990cc09c73c9cf4b46682e39888a
spent
true